Song Meaning
The lyrics present a simple, almost mantra-like repetition of "Peace, Love and Happiness." This constant refrain creates an immediate sense of an ideal state or a desired outcome. The sheer repetition suggests a powerful yearning for these abstract concepts, almost as if stating them aloud is an attempt to manifest them into reality. It’s a direct, unadorned expression of a fundamental human aspiration. The core tension here lies in the contrast between the stated ideals and the implied reality. While the words themselves are positive and aspirational, their relentless repetition can also suggest a certain emptiness or a desperate plea. The lyrics don't offer any narrative or context, leaving the listener to fill in the blanks, which might include the absence of these very things. This ambiguity is where the emotional weight resides. The most striking aspect of the craft is the extreme minimalism. By stripping away all other lyrical elements, the focus is solely on the power and potential hollowness of these three words. The absence of any descriptive language forces the listener to confront the concepts themselves, making the repetition feel both like a celebration and a lament. It’s a bold choice that amplifies the emotional impact through sheer sonic and semantic focus. Ultimately, these lyrics resonate because they tap into a universal desire for well-being and harmony. The simple, repetitive structure makes the message accessible and memorable, while the lack of specific detail allows for broad interpretation. It’s effective because it bypasses complex storytelling to hit directly at a core human hope, leaving the listener to ponder the presence or absence of peace, love, and happiness in their own lives.
